Why does this exist?

Government job postings — especially from small towns — are scattered across hundreds of individual municipal websites. Most never appear on Indeed, LinkedIn, or Handshake. We scrape them all into one searchable place so you don't have to check each town's site individually.

I'm in high school — can I find a job here?

Yes. Click the Summer jobs quick-pick or set the Job Category filter to Seasonal. Many towns hire teens for camps, lifeguarding, parks & rec, swim instruction, and youth programs. Some have a minimum age (usually 15 or 16) noted in the posting.

I'm a college student looking for an internship.

Set the Job Category filter to Internship, or click the Internships quick-pick. Public-sector internships sit in town planning offices, finance departments, public works, library systems, state agencies, and legislative offices. Many are paid; some offer academic credit.

I don't have a college degree.

Click the No degree required quick-pick. There are real, full-benefits public-sector careers in public works, transfer stations, custodial, school facilities, transit, water/sewer, and clerical that don't require a bachelor's. Many municipalities also pay for licenses or training (CDL, water operator, etc.).

What does "Entry-Level" mean?

It's a job that's open to people without prior years of experience in that field — first-time workers, recent grads, career-changers. The posting may still expect a degree or specific license; check the job page for details.
